Can – Ege Bamyasi
Label: | United Artists Records – UAS 29 414 I |
---|---|
Format: | Vinyl, LP, Album, Stereo |
Country: | Germany |
Released: | |
Genre: | Rock |
Style: | Krautrock, Experimental |
Tracklist
A1 | Pinch | 9:28 | |
A2 | Sing Swan Song | 4:18 | |
A3 | One More Night | 5:35 | |
B1 | Vitamin C | 3:34 | |
B2 | Soup | 10:25 | |
B3 | I'm So Green | 3:03 | |
B4 | Spoon | 3:03 |
Companies, etc.
- Recorded At – Inner Space Studio
- Pressed By – Sonopress
- Printed By – Druckhaus Maack
- Record Company – Transamerica Corporation
- Record Company – Liberty/UA GmbH
Credits
- Art Direction – Ingo Trauer, Richard J. Rudow
- Composed By [All Compositions], Arranged By [Arrangements Written By], Producer [Produced By] – Can
- Electric Bass [E. Bass], Engineer [Recording Engineer] – Holger Czukay
- Engineer [Assistant] – Uli Gerlach
- Guitar, Acoustic Guitar [Acc.- G.], Twelve-String Guitar [12 String-G.], Shenai – Michael Caroli*
- Organ, Electric Piano [E.-Piano], Violin [Violine], Steel Guitar [Steel-G.] – Irmin Schmidt
- Percussion, Percussion [Flexaton] – Jaki Liebezeit
- Vocals [Vocal] – Kenji "Damo" Suzuki*
Notes
Recorded at Inner Space Studios in 1972

Laminated jacket front with printed inner sleeve.
Catalog# on sleeve "UAS 29 414 I", on labels "29 414 I"
Some copies came with large (approx. 22"x29") poster with image from back cover and yellow CAN text near top.
Some copies have a promo sticker (see picture).
Some copies may have a "Including 1 Poster "Spoon"" sticker.
Made in Germany
